GitHub hosts millions of open source projects, and staying updated on their latest releases is essential for any developer workflow. Whether you're tracking a frontend framework like React or Vue, a backend tool like Supabase or Prisma, or a build utility like Vite or Turbopack, knowing when a new version drops helps you plan upgrades, adopt security patches, and take advantage of new features.
